Jimmy is back! Although Drake has pursued a rap career while some of his other Degrassi co-stars have continued acting and others have just disappeared, ole Jimmy and the rest of the cast haven’t forgotten about Degrassi Community School.
Drake dropped the visuals to his song “I’m Upset” and paid homage to his Degrassi: The Next Generation days. Drake’s character, Jimmy Brooks, appeared alongside some of our childhood faves, such as Shane “Spinnerq” Kippel, Nina “Mia” Dobrev and Miriam “Emma” McDonald, to name a few.

The video was directed by Karena Evans, 22, who was also behind the “God’s Plan” and “Nice for What” videos. Evans, who started her journey interning for Director X, has definitely been adding meaning to Drake’s videos. Her journey has been continually progressing; she was the first female recipient of the Prism Prize’s Lipsett Award for her innovative approach to directing music videos.
